Home
last modified time | relevance | path

Searched refs:ifreq (Results 1 - 25 of 47) sorted by relevance

12

/foundation/communication/dsoftbus/components/nstackx/nstackx_util/platform/liteos/
H A Dsys_dev.c42 static int32_t GetInterfaceInfo(int32_t fd, int32_t option, struct ifreq *interface) in GetInterfaceInfo()
64 int32_t GetInterfaceIP(int32_t fd, struct ifreq *interface) in GetInterfaceIP()
69 static int32_t GetInterfaceNetMask(int32_t fd, struct ifreq *interface) in GetInterfaceNetMask()
74 int32_t GetInterfaceList(struct ifconf *ifc, struct ifreq *buf, uint32_t size) in GetInterfaceList()
92 struct ifreq buf[INTERFACE_MAX]; in GetConnectionTypeByDev()
103 int32_t ifreqLen = (int32_t)sizeof(struct ifreq); in GetConnectionTypeByDev()
133 static int32_t FindDevByInterfaceIP(int32_t fd, struct ifconf ifc, struct ifreq buf[], uint32_t sourceIP) in FindDevByInterfaceIP()
136 int32_t ifreqLen = (int32_t)sizeof(struct ifreq); in FindDevByInterfaceIP()
155 struct ifreq buf[INTERFACE_MAX]; in GetInterfaceNameByIP()
175 static int32_t BindToDeviceInner(int32_t sockfd, const struct ifreq *ifBindin
[all...]
H A Dsys_util.h81 NSTACKX_EXPORT int32_t GetInterfaceList(struct ifconf *ifc, struct ifreq *buf, uint32_t size);
82 NSTACKX_EXPORT int32_t GetInterfaceIP(int32_t fd, struct ifreq *interface);
83 NSTACKX_EXPORT int32_t GetTargetInterface(const struct sockaddr_in *dstAddr, struct ifreq *localDev);
/foundation/communication/dsoftbus/components/nstackx/nstackx_util/platform/unix/
H A Dsys_dev.c42 static int32_t GetInterfaceInfo(int32_t fd, int32_t option, struct ifreq *interface) in GetInterfaceInfo()
64 int32_t GetInterfaceIP(int32_t fd, struct ifreq *interface) in GetInterfaceIP()
69 static int32_t GetInterfaceNetMask(int32_t fd, struct ifreq *interface) in GetInterfaceNetMask()
74 int32_t GetInterfaceList(struct ifconf *ifc, struct ifreq *buf, uint32_t size) in GetInterfaceList()
92 struct ifreq buf[INTERFACE_MAX]; in GetConnectionTypeByDev()
103 int32_t ifreqLen = (int32_t)sizeof(struct ifreq); in GetConnectionTypeByDev()
133 static int32_t FindDevByInterfaceIP(int32_t fd, struct ifconf ifc, struct ifreq buf[], uint32_t sourceIP) in FindDevByInterfaceIP()
136 int32_t ifreqLen = (int32_t)sizeof(struct ifreq); in FindDevByInterfaceIP()
155 struct ifreq buf[INTERFACE_MAX]; in GetInterfaceNameByIP()
175 static int32_t BindToDeviceInner(int32_t sockfd, const struct ifreq *ifBindin
[all...]
H A Dsys_util.h58 NSTACKX_EXPORT int32_t GetInterfaceList(struct ifconf *ifc, struct ifreq *buf, uint32_t size);
59 NSTACKX_EXPORT int32_t GetInterfaceIP(int32_t fd, struct ifreq *interface);
60 NSTACKX_EXPORT int32_t GetTargetInterface(const struct sockaddr_in *dstAddr, struct ifreq *localDev);
/foundation/communication/netmanager_base/services/netmanagernative/src/manager/
H A Ddistributed_manager.cpp58 ifreq ifr{}; in CreateDistributedInterface()
82 int32_t DistributedManager::SetDistributedNicResult(std::atomic_int &fd, unsigned long cmd, ifreq &ifr) in SetDistributedNicResult()
94 int32_t DistributedManager::InitIfreq(ifreq &ifr, const std::string &cardName) in InitIfreq()
114 ifreq ifr{}; in SetDistributedNicMtu()
132 ifreq ifr{}; in SetDistributedNicAddress()
173 ifreq ifr{}; in SetDistributedNicUp()
192 ifreq ifr{}; in SetDistributedNicDown()
H A Dvpn_manager.cpp54 ifreq ifr = {}; in CreateVpnInterface()
110 int32_t VpnManager::SetVpnResult(std::atomic_int &fd, unsigned long cmd, ifreq &ifr) in SetVpnResult()
128 ifreq ifr; in SetVpnMtu()
147 ifreq ifr = {}; in SetVpnAddress()
203 ifreq ifr = {}; in SetVpnUp()
222 ifreq ifr = {}; in SetVpnDown()
239 int32_t VpnManager::InitIfreq(ifreq &ifr, const std::string &cardName) in InitIfreq()
H A Dvnic_manager.cpp78 ifreq ifr{}; in CreateVnicInterface()
136 int32_t VnicManager::SetVnicResult(std::atomic_int &fd, unsigned long cmd, ifreq &ifr) in SetVnicResult()
156 ifreq ifr; in SetVnicMtu()
175 ifreq ifr{}; in SetVnicAddress()
231 ifreq ifr{}; in SetVnicUp()
250 ifreq ifr{}; in SetVnicDown()
283 int32_t VnicManager::InitIfreq(ifreq &ifr, const std::string &cardName) in InitIfreq()
H A Dinterface_manager.cpp131 struct ifreq ifr; in SetMtu()
299 struct ifreq ifr = {}; in GetIfaceConfig()
325 struct ifreq ifr = {}; in SetIfaceConfig()
377 struct ifreq ifr; in SetIpAddress()
408 struct ifreq ifr; in SetIffUp()
/foundation/communication/netmanager_base/services/netmanagernative/include/manager/
H A Dvnic_manager.h57 int32_t InitIfreq(ifreq &ifr, const std::string &cardName);
58 int32_t SetVnicResult(std::atomic_int &fd, unsigned long cmd, ifreq &ifr);
H A Dvpn_manager.h48 int32_t InitIfreq(ifreq &ifr, const std::string &cardName);
49 int32_t SetVpnResult(std::atomic_int &fd, unsigned long cmd, ifreq &ifr);
H A Ddistributed_manager.h57 int32_t InitIfreq(ifreq &ifr, const std::string &cardName);
58 int32_t SetDistributedNicResult(std::atomic_int &fd, unsigned long cmd, ifreq &ifr);
/foundation/communication/dsoftbus/adapter/common/kernel/posix/
H A Dlnn_ip_utils_adapter.c26 static int32_t GetNetworkIfIp(int32_t fd, struct ifreq *req, char *ip, char *netmask, uint32_t len) in GetNetworkIfIp()
71 struct ifreq ifr; in GetNetworkIpByIfName()
/foundation/communication/netmanager_base/test/netmanagernative/unittest/netsys_manager_test/
H A Dnetsys_native_client_test.cpp289 struct ifreq ifreq = {}; in HWTEST_F() local
294 nativeClient_.EnableVirtualNetIfaceCard(SOCKET_FD, ifreq, ifacefd1); in HWTEST_F()
298 nativeClient_.EnableVirtualNetIfaceCard(sockfd, ifreq, ifacefd2); in HWTEST_F()
306 struct ifreq ifreq = {}; in HWTEST_F() local
308 ret = nativeClient_.SetIpAddress(sockfd, LOCALIP, PREFIX_LENGTH, ifreq); in HWTEST_F()
H A Dvnic_manager_test.cpp92 ifreq ifr; in HWTEST_F()
H A Dvpn_manager_test.cpp78 ifreq ifr; in HWTEST_F()
H A Dmock_netsys_native_client_test.cpp211 struct ifreq ifRequest = {}; in HWTEST_F()
225 struct ifreq ifRequest = {}; in HWTEST_F()
/foundation/communication/bluetooth_service/services/bluetooth/service/src/pan/
H A Dpan_network.cpp99 struct ifreq ifr; in TunSetIff()
121 struct ifreq ifr; in SetMacAddress()
157 struct ifreq ifr; in SetIpAddress()
206 struct ifreq ifr; in SetIffUp()
231 struct ifreq ifr; in SetIffdown()
/foundation/communication/dsoftbus/tests/core/bus_center/lnn/unittest/
H A Dnet_buscenter_test.cpp116 struct ifreq ifr; in SetIpaddr()
163 struct ifreq ifr; in SetIpDown()
/foundation/communication/dhcp/services/dhcp_client/src/
H A Ddhcp_function.cpp153 struct ifreq iface; in GetLocalInterface()
265 struct ifreq ifr; in SetIpOrMask()
267 if (memset_s(&ifr, sizeof(struct ifreq), 0, sizeof(struct ifreq)) != EOK) { in SetIpOrMask()
/foundation/communication/netmanager_base/services/netsyscontroller/include/
H A Dmock_netsys_native_client.h411 int32_t EnableVirtualNetIfaceCard(int32_t socketFd, struct ifreq &ifRequest, int32_t &ifaceFd);
422 int32_t SetIpAddress(int32_t socketFd, const std::string &ipAddress, int32_t prefixLen, struct ifreq &ifRequest);
/foundation/communication/netmanager_base/test/netmanagernative/unittest/netsys_distributed_test/
H A Ddistributed_manager_test.cpp96 ifreq ifr; in HWTEST_F()
/foundation/communication/wifi/wifi/services/wifi_standard/wifi_framework/wifi_toolkit/net_helper/
H A Dif_config.cpp126 struct ifreq ifr; in FlushIpAddr()
129 LOGE("Init the ifreq struct failed!"); in FlushIpAddr()
167 struct ifreq ifr; in AddIpAddr()
258 struct ifreq ifr; in GetIpAddr()
H A Dmac_address.cpp142 struct ifreq ifr; in GetMacAddr()
145 LOGE("Init the ifreq struct failed!"); in GetMacAddr()
/foundation/communication/dsoftbus/components/nstackx/nstackx_ctrl/core/
H A Dnstackx_device_local.c588 struct ifreq req[INTERFACE_MAX]; in DetectLocalIface()
595 int interfaceNum = ifc.ifc_len / (int)sizeof(struct ifreq); in DetectLocalIface()
730 struct ifreq req; in LocalIfaceGetCoapCtxByRemoteIp()
731 (void)memset_s(&req, sizeof(struct ifreq), 0, sizeof(struct ifreq)); in LocalIfaceGetCoapCtxByRemoteIp()
/foundation/communication/wifi/wifi/relation_services/common/
H A Dwifi_hal_common_func.c140 struct ifreq ifr; in GetIfaceState()

Completed in 14 milliseconds

12